首页 文档 博客 资源 招聘 论坛 |
点点滴滴
访问地址:http://wangf.javaeedev.com » 复制 » 收藏 » 订阅
博客首页 » 最新文章
发表于08-05-12 13:28 | 阅读 64 | 评分 (暂无)

淘宝的收货地址栏是不是做的有问题?
在淘宝上买了东西,卖家说看不到我的门牌号码,只看到单位名称
什么原因呢,再看了下我的收获栏地址,我填写的格式是:
“xxx路xxx号
xxx单位”
因为淘宝的收货地址是一个textarea,我毫不犹豫地在门牌号码和单位之间换了个行,难道是中间的回车除了问题???
然后我把中间的回车去掉了,就看到了新的包含了门牌号码和单位名称的地址,呵呵
发表于08-05-09 17:08 | 阅读 86 | 评分 (暂无)

记录问题和初步的猜测:
1.query cache和session factory cache是什么关系?
个人感觉是关系比较紧密,但到底什么关系不清楚。
2.query cache在通过hibernate插了新纪录后会失效吗,重开session后的情况如何?
在同一个session中插了新纪录,导致其他的都失效,重开session后,query cache的查询语句转成了session factory cache的ID查询语句,当然这是在同一个session factory open session的情况下,如果是重新运行服务器,只要没新纪录,原来的select语句只运行一次。
以上纯属猜测,欢迎拍砖
发表于08-05-07 18:06 | 阅读 102 | 评分 (暂无)

有的数据库区分,有的数据库不区分,其实这和什么数据库没太大关系,主要是和数据库的collate有关,这些参数一般都是可以调整的,呵呵
发表于08-05-05 01:39 | 阅读 162 | 评分 (暂无)

教训,惨痛的教训,浪费了一晚上的时间,最终还是靠搜索异常找到网友的解决办法
http://liyanhui.javaeye.com/blog/133275
一个timestamp的类型值为null
这样hibernate就无法映射了???
原因已知,解决办法未知
 
======================
后记:现在知道确切的原因了,因为这个field在composite-id中
所以一旦value为null,就会出问题了
本人已知的解决办法就是要小心,不要让这样的情况出现
发表于08-04-27 01:54 | 阅读 279 | 评分 (暂无)

ctrl+F6在eclipse中是在editor中切换你要编辑的哪个source的
可惜这两个键隔太远,一只手极为不便
而ctrl+tab的键却去做了意义不大的事情,曾经想改下快捷键设置,但没成功
盼指教
发表于08-04-15 11:08 | 阅读 299 | 评分 (暂无)

手动自动都无法进行,昨晚上折腾了两个小时,把项目的myeclipse属性去掉后,再添上来,成功编译了一次,然后又照旧。看log,没什么信息,不过我把myeclipse删掉时,报builder的错。而且本来myeclipse会加上若干的builder,今天早上看时,居然只有一个。比较了和其他项目的区别,发现我连java builder都没有,于是对比修改了.project文件,重启,OK。
发表于08-04-03 02:48 | 阅读 263 | 评分 (暂无)

懒得写程序,想直接在elipse的查找替换dialog中用正则表达式替换。
很简单的一个操作把","替换成"," + 换行,死活没成功。如果把要替换的字符串写成",\n"的话,会直接替换成",n"。而我在查找的那个field中用"alt+/"看到"/n"就是换行,为什么不行呢,后来偶然地在替换的field中也用"alt+/"看看了,居然没有看到,只有三个选项,难道问题出在这里吗,真郁闷
发表于08-03-25 17:05 | 阅读 416 | 评分 (暂无)

读者如果需要下载配套光盘中的源码,可以从地址: http://code.google.com/p/livebookstore/downloads/list 下载LiveBookstore的源码及最新更新版本。 如果需要各章的示例源代码,请先在Eclipse中安装Subversion插件,然后直接从Subversion库中检出即可。具体使用方法请参考文章:http://ww.javaeedev.com/blog/article.jspx
这是从当当的书评中看到的,找的我好辛苦
 
 
发表于08-03-18 15:07 | 阅读 651 | 评分 (暂无)

在最近的项目中,客户要求采用OC4J容器,所以开发过程中出现了不少问题。
先是Hibernate的AST解析器无法过,必须采用Classic的方式才能过,分析得出的原因是OC4J里的TOPLINK也使用了antlr包,结果和Hibernate的冲突了,这个问题在OC4J部署指南里有详解,只要添入一个orion-application的xml,去除继承的toplink即可。
后来我们用的eclipse xsd无法正常工作,而且报的错从来都没见过,当时一筹莫展,在试用了旧版本之后,偶沿用了旧版本中用jaxp1.2替换jdk自带解析的办法,1.5中用外置的jaxp1.3替换了内置的,这才明白是解析器的问题,再到网上搜搜,在参考一中发现了更简单的办法,即在WEB-INF下添加一个orion-web.xml,
内容为:


 xsi:noNamespaceSchemaLocation="http://xmlns.oracle.com/oracleas/schema/orion-web-10_0.xsd ...
发表于08-03-04 21:50 | 阅读 537 | 评分 (暂无)

在dom4j里,直接在root element上addNamespace是无法成功的,因为是默认的,所以prefix必须给空字符串,结果导致了root的直接子结点都产生了xmlns=""的属性
诸如:
<root xmlns="http://wangf.javaeedev.com">
   <blog xmln="">
    <aticles>...</aticles>
  </blog>
  <forum xmlns="">
    <topics>...</topics>
  </forum>
</root>
的形式,想了很多办法,都不满意,后来在网上发现msxml也存在同样的问题,看着人 ...
25项,3页: 上一页 1 2 3 下一页
自我介绍 »
等级:
搜索文章 »
文章分类 »
最新发表 »
最新评论 »